Write two functions called gcd and lcm

Assignment Help Computer Engineering
Reference no: EM131306907

Assignment - Function

1. Write the following function's prototype:

function name

return type

input data type

cubic

double

Two input of double values

delete_blanks

none

none

random

integer

none

2. Write a function prime that return 1 if its argument is a prime number and return 0 otherwise.

3. Write a function called arraysum that takes two arguments: integer array and the number of elements in the array. Have the function return as its result the sum of the element in the array.

4. Modify the sort function to take a third argument indicating whether the array is to be sorted in ascending order or descending order. Then modify the sort algorithm to correctly sort the array into the indicated order.

5. Write two functions called Gcd and Lcm. The Gcd function takes two positive integers as its parameters and returns their greatest common divisor. The Lcm function takes two positive integers as its parameters and returns their least common multiple. The Lcm function should calculate the least common multiple by calling the Gcd function.

6. Write a recursive function to calculate the nth power of x.

2388_Figure.png

Reference no: EM131306907

Questions Cloud

How would we apply this framework to the real world : What is the production possibilities curve and how is it useful? What 4 factors contribute to determining any point in this model? How would we apply this framework to the real world?
Discuss a popular national product or service : Discuss a popular national product or service that is using integrated marketing communications effectively.Include specific examples of their promotional activities from the different promotional mix categories.
How much of private good will george donate in equilibrium : How much of the private good will George donate in equilibrium. What does it mean for a good to be non-excludable? In theory one may worry that such a problem could completely shut down private markets.
Develop pricing strategies-distribution channels for product : Develop strategies to assess performance and achieve marketing goals.Develop pricing strategies and distribution channels for products.Analyze integrated marketing communications and its relationship to advertising strategy.Evaluate marketing researc..
Write two functions called gcd and lcm : Write two functions called Gcd and Lcm. The Gcd function takes two positive integers as its parameters and returns their greatest common divisor. The Lcm function takes two positive integers as its parameters and returns their least common multipl..
What is the risk profile of your firm : As a financial analyst, you have been asked to analyze a firm. Your task is to make a recommendation as to whether or not to invest in this firm given the analysis you undertake.
Discuss any potential ethical or social responsible issues : Provide a brief history of them both. (Select an existing publicly owned company. View the link Public Companies for a comprehensive list of publicly traded companies.)  Identify/ create/ build a Marketing Mix for this product as it is today.  Disc..
Write the first section of the marketing plan : create a complete Marketing Plan by the end of the course. You will write the first section of the Marketing Plan for this assignment. Use the guide to identify the sections of the Marketing Plan and the marketing elements contained therein. This ..
Write a function which takes three integer parameters : Write a function which takes three integer parameters, computes their average as a double, and prints the average. This function does not return a value

Reviews

Write a Review

Computer Engineering Questions & Answers

  If a class is derived protected from a base class describe

if a class is derived protected from a base class explain how this affects the inheritance of all the public protected

  What is the history of osi model and benefits

Why you will recommend either asymmetric key encryption, symmetric key encryption, or no encryption at all for the Email correspondence.

  Briefly explain some of the issues that a company may face

information systems use security policy write a paper consisting of 500-1000 words double spaced about your experience

  Design an asynchronous base counter

Design an asynchronous base 14 counter that counts through the natural binary sequence from 0 (0000) to 13 (1101) and then returns to zero on the next count.

  How to figure out possibly stacks, queues and trees

How to figure out  possibly stacks, queues and trees

  What is the value shown by the bit string

What is the value shown by the bit string 101101 if - Negate the following binary numbers in 4-bit 2's complement representation - How large a value can be represented by each of the unsigned binary quantities?

  Collection of the volatile data for investigation

Discuss with others what kinds of the data are considered volatile and the methods through which the investigators should collect and preserve the volatile data. Recognize the consequences of not collecting or preserving the volatile data to the i..

  Program that has a function named presentvalue

Program that has a function named presentValue

  Describe the sources of potential errors in the final set

question 1 what is the relationship between precision and turr.question 2 discuss the sources of potential errors in

  Questionhow do you draw a hierarchy chart and propose the

questionhow do you draw a hierarchy chart and propose the logic for a program that contains housekeeping feature loop

  What is csma/cd

What do you feel is the future for Token Ring? What are its advantages or disadvantages.

  Give promising technology for the effective automation

Web services are emerging as a promising technology for the effective automation of inter-organizational interactions. How do you see you company being involved in Web Services in the future.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d